Growing Demand (August 1, 2008)

The increase in fuel prices this summer has brought more customers to dealers’ showrooms nationwide to view and purchase TOMOS mopeds and scooters.  Dealers affirm that their customers are deciding to park their cars, trucks, and even motorcycles for better fuel mileage that the 50cc and 150cc TOMOS units obtain.  Gasoline prices might fall later in the year, but overall consumers’ minds have been made up that higher fuel prices are here to stay.

“Scooters and mopeds have always been an economic means of transportation” states TOMOS USA’s Sales Manger Doug Joseph.  “In Europe, Asia, South America, scooters and mopeds are a great way to get from point A to point B.  I think the USA is just starting to come around to using mass transit and now scooters and mopeds in some areas.”

TOMOS USA’s supply had been sold out during the June and July 08 time frame, but expects more supply in August.  TOMOS USA’s Doug Joseph thinks that supply will catch back up to demand although it will be early in the 4th quarter.
